Description

The Fiskars PowerGear™ X Tree Pruner provides an extended reach for cutting fresh wood up to 32mm in diameter. The shaft length is adjustable from 2.4-4m, providing a maximum reach of 6m and a 230° adjustable cutting head. Fitted with durable SoftGrip™ handles and a non-slip base with orange cutting support for added visibility. Allows access to tree crowns and dense bushes, enabling the gardener to trim overhead without needing a ladder, or at ground level without bending or kneeling. Specification: Cutting Capacity: 32mmVertical Cutting Reach: 6mLength: 2.4-4mWeight: 1900g

FISKARSVisit the FISKARS store
Fiskars, founded in 1649, is one of the oldest companies in the world and is named after a village 100 km from Helsinki in Finland. Originally, Fiskars made metal objects, tools, knives and nails.... In 1964, Fiskars launched its iconic orange-handled scissors, which are still one of the brand's best-sellers. In the 1980s, Fiskars launched axes with handles made from a revolutionary unbreakable fibreglass material called "Fiber comp". Always at the forefront of innovation, the brand is renowned for its scissors, hand tools for gardening, woodcutting and DIY. The result of extensive research and development, Fiskars products are functional, high-performance and durable to reduce effort and maximise gardening pleasure. The Fiskars group is committed to sustainable development, supporting projects to promote eco-responsible behaviour and changing its industrial processes for cleaner production in order to limit its carbon footprint.
